Rifles: Procurement

Asked by James CartlidgeConservativeMinistry of DefenceTabled Answered 14 May 2025UIN 50538

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Defence, whether UK sovereign capability will be considered in the procurement of a replacement for the SA80 rifle.

Answered by Maria Eagle

Project GRAYBURN aims to replace the L85 family of rifles with a new weapon system fit for future warfare. This will be achieved in partnership with industry by growing UK sovereign manufacturing skills and infrastructure.

The Ministry of Defence is committed to investing in our nation’s prosperity and supporting and developing our competitive industrial base through provision of education, skills and jobs. The Defence Industrial Strategy will articulate how best Defence can contribute to sovereign operational independence, including in the production of small arms.
